In the Philippines, variations of the Baro't saya adapted to the white wedding ceremony custom are thought-about to be marriage ceremony attire for girls, together with the Barong Tagalog for men. Various tribes and Muslim Filipinos don other types of conventional gown during their respective ceremonies. Material - The amount of fabric a wedding dress contained was a mirrored image of the bride's social standing. For occasion, the more sleeves flowed, the longer the practice, the richer the bride's family was apt to be. Medieval brides of an elevated social standing wore rich colors, expensive materials and sometimes
gems sewn into the garment.

American heiress Evelyn Byrd Dows was married at her family's home, Carlton Hall, in Long Island, New York, in 1933. The bride, photographed along with her husband Cornelius Newton Bliss, wore a satin and lace wedding ceremony gown designed by Hattie Carnegie.
